Twilio needs to consolidate its demo platform across Communications and Segment for the first time, requiring the creation, maintenance, and design of a full-stack demo platform to showcase Twilio's entire product suite and drive cross-sell and multiproduct adoption.
Requirements
- 5+ years of experience in software development, with a strong understanding of RESTful APIs, web frameworks and integrating SaaS platforms.
- Strong knowledge of Javascript/Typescript including experience using Node and React with the ability to quickly learn and adapt to new technologies as needed.
- Working knowledge of architecting and building agentic applications using latest technologies including MCP and frameworks such as Langchain.
- Experience developing and deploying full stack, web-based applications with a focus on creating intuitive user interfaces and seamless user experiences.
- Familiarity with cloud computing concepts and platforms such as Snowflake, Databricks, GCP, AWS is a plus.
- Familiarity with the CPaaS API space, working with Twilio’s APIs, and prior CPaaS coding experience a huge plus
- Experience with React, NextJS or similar frameworks.
Responsibilities
- Build comprehensive web applications and product demos that solve business use cases for Solutions Engineers to leverage in customer facing calls.
- Utilize your software engineering expertise to build and maintain Twilio’s demo platform, demo environments and demo tooling, including integrations with other partner technology.
- Develop visually appealing, interactive demo environments using a range of tools, empowering AEs and SEs to provide self-service demos that highlight delightful user experiences.
- Stay abreast of new products, product updates and enhancements to incorporate them into the demo environments as appropriate to showcase the latest features and improvements.
- Apply first principle thinking to reimagine how Twilio’s products can be built and demonstrated and bring these ideas to life.
- Gather feedback from end users and use insights to continuously enhance and refine demo content and delivery.
